Bosnia's Damir Dzumhur plays a backhand return to Spain's Alejandro Davidovich Fokina during their men's singles match on day 1 of the French Open tennis tournament at the Roland-Garros Complex in Paris on May 24, 2026. ANNE-CHRISTINE POUJOULAT / AFP The French Open started amid a heat wave in Paris on Sunday, May 24. Among the early matches on Day 1 of the clay-court Grand Slam were 13th-seeded Karen Khachanov against Arthur Gea on Court Suzanne-Lenglen and 15th-seeded Marta Kostyuk against Oksana Selekhmeteva on Court Simonne-Mathieu. The temperature was already 26°C when play started at 11 am local time and was due to soar to 31°C. Spectators folded newspapers in half and fanned themselves to keep cool as players on court attempted to stay hydrated.
